What is an Amazon Virtual Assistant?
An Amazon Virtual Assistant is someone who works remotely and specializes in handling tasks specific to Amazon. They are knowledgeable about Amazon's platform and can manage a variety of tasks, from finding the right products to sell to handling customer inquiries. Essentially, they become a part of your team, allowing you to focus on big-picture strategies while they handle the daily tasks.
What Does an Amazon Virtual Assistant Do?
- Product Research and Listing Optimization
- Finding profitable products to sell on Amazon.
- Making product listings more attractive with better titles, descriptions, and keywords.
- Creating eye-catching product images and enhancing listings with detailed content.
- Order Processing and Inventory Management
- Keeping track of stock levels and restocking when necessary.
- Processing orders and ensuring they are shipped on time.
- Managing Amazon’s fulfillment options, like FBA and FBM.
- Customer Service and Feedback Management
- Responding to customer questions and resolving issues quickly.
- Handling returns and refunds according to Amazon’s policies.
- Collecting and analyzing customer feedback to improve your products.
- SEO and Keyword Optimization for Product Listings
- Finding the right keywords that can help your products rank higher in search results.
- Optimizing product listings with these keywords to increase visibility.
- Adjusting SEO strategies based on how well your listings are performing.
- Monitoring and Responding to Customer Reviews
- Keeping an eye on customer reviews and ratings.
- Responding to both positive and negative reviews professionally.
- Using feedback to identify areas where your products can be improved.
- Managing PPC Campaigns and Advertising Budgets
- Setting up and optimizing Amazon PPC campaigns.
- Monitoring ad performance and adjusting budgets as needed.
- Identifying high-performing keywords and products to maximize returns.
- Analyzing Sales Data and Performance Metrics
- Reviewing sales reports and performance metrics to spot trends.
- Providing insights to improve profitability.
- Tracking key performance indicators like conversion rates and profit margins.
- Handling Returns and Refunds
- Processing returns and issuing refunds as per Amazon’s policies.
- Resolving disputes and ensuring customer satisfaction.
- Analyzing reasons for returns to reduce future occurrences.
- Maintaining Compliance with Amazon’s Policies
- Staying updated on Amazon’s changing policies and guidelines.
- Ensuring all listings and practices comply with these policies to avoid penalties.
- Addressing any compliance issues promptly to maintain account health.
- Coordinating with Suppliers and Logistics Partners
- Communicating with suppliers to ensure timely delivery of products.
- Coordinating with logistics partners to optimize shipping processes.
- Negotiating better terms and rates with suppliers and logistics providers.
By delegating these tasks to an Amazon Virtual Assistant, you can save valuable time and focus on growing your business and exploring new opportunities.

How to Find the Right Amazon Virtual Assistant
Finding the right Amazon Virtual Assistant is crucial to maximizing the benefits they can bring to your business.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you find the perfect VA:
1. Define Your Needs
- Start by identifying the specific tasks you want to outsource. Are you struggling with product research, customer service, or inventory management? Knowing your needs will help you find a VA with the right skills and experience.
2. Check Experience
- Look for VAs with a proven track record of working on Amazon. Experience with tasks like product listing optimization, PPC management, and customer service is essential.
3. Platforms to Hire From
- There are several platforms where you can find qualified Amazon Virtual Assistants. Some popular options include:
- Upwork: A freelance marketplace with a wide range of talent.
- Fiverr: A platform where you can find specialized VAs at competitive rates.
- Specialized VA Agencies: Some agencies focus specifically on eCommerce and Amazon services, offering highly skilled VAs.
4. Trial Period
- Before committing to a long-term partnership, consider hiring a VA for a small project or trial period. This will give you a chance to assess their skills, communication, and work ethic.
5. Clear Communication
- Ensure you and your VA are on the same page from the start. Clearly communicate your expectations, goals, and any specific processes you want them to follow.
6. Ask for References
- Don’t hesitate to ask for references or examples of previous work. A reputable VA will be happy to provide testimonials or case studies from past clients.
7. Check Their Knowledge of Amazon’s Policies
- Amazon’s policies can be complex, so it’s important to hire a VA who is well-versed in them. Look for VAs who can demonstrate their understanding of compliance and account health.
8. Evaluate Their Technical Skills
- Ensure your VA is proficient in the tools and software commonly used for eCommerce management, such as Jungle Scout, Helium 10, or Seller Central.
9. Assess Their Problem-Solving Skills
- An Amazon VA should be able to think critically and solve problems effectively. Look for VAs who can provide creative solutions to common eCommerce challenges.
10. Consider Cultural Fit
- While not always necessary, hiring a VA who shares your business values and work ethic can lead to a more harmonious and productive working relationship.
